In SQL Dialog some Junk Chinese character getting listed down in Server combo
Basic MSI project was created in IS 2013. Localization support was added for Chinese language for the product. Project is using SQL scripts view to execute sql scripts.
Now in the SQL Dialog i am seeing some Junk Chinese character getting listed down in Server combo box.
How to resolve this issue.
Any help is very much appreciated.

Ah, thanks for reporting the update. This fix was included in the service pack for InstallShield 2013. You may want to consider getting the service pack.
To learn what's included in SP1, see the InstallShield 2013/InstallShield 2013 SP1 release notes. Here's a link:
